ancillary lines definition

ancillary lines means any electric lines of the Licensee except (a) electric lines which are comprised in the Licensee's Transmission System or Distribution System and (b) electric lines through which the Licensee supplies electricity to premises pursuant to a Licence granted under Section 6(2)(a) of the Act.
